MySQL是一種廣泛使用的關系型數據庫管理系統,而UTF-8則是一種常見的字符編碼方式。在MySQL中,設置UTF-8編碼方式可以確保數據庫中的數據可以支持多種語言,從而提高了應用程序的國際化能力。本文將詳細介紹MySQL UTF-8設置的相關內容。
一、MySQL字符集簡介
1icode編碼方式,能夠支持世界上幾乎所有的字符集。
二、MySQL UTF-8設置方法
yf文件來設置UTF-8編碼方式。具體步驟如下:
yf文件,可以使用以下命令:
(2)添加以下內容到文件末尾:
default-character-set=utf8
ysqld]itnect='SET NAMES utf8'
character-set-server=utf8eral_ci
(3)保存并關閉文件。
(4)重啟MySQL服務,可以使用以下命令:
ysqld restart
2. 修改數據庫和表的字符集
yf文件外,還可以通過修改數據庫和表的字符集來設置UTF-8編碼方式。具體步驟如下:
(1)創建數據庫時,可以使用以下命令:
ameeral_ci;
(2)創建表時,可以使用以下命令:
ame (n1eral_ci,n2eral_ci,
...
(3)修改已有表的字符集,可以使用以下命令:
ameeral_ci;
三、MySQL UTF-8設置注意事項
yf文件時,需要注意文件路徑和權限。
2. 修改數據庫和表的字符集時,需要注意數據備份和恢復。
3. 修改字符集后,需要重啟MySQL服務才能生效。
4. 在使用UTF-8編碼方式時,需要注意字符長度和排序規則。
總之,在使用MySQL時,設置UTF-8編碼方式是非常重要的,可以提高應用程序的國際化能力,也可以避免出現字符集不兼容的問題。希望本文對您有所幫助。